Transaction 0645d159edb6af21a1768710ffc81a20763e2c9a2678d2ef039c87ee13bcf977
1 Input
1 Output
-
0645d159edb6af21a1768710ffc81a20763e2c9a2678d2ef039c87ee13bcf977:0
- value
- 24836
- script pubkey
- OP_0 OP_PUSHBYTES_32 e0aeac80baccc51795a86c6267d71a56da84c336f97de82b0f6b3244a7680cda
- address
- bc1quzh2eq96enz309dgd33x04c62mdgfsekl977s2c0dveyffmgpndqyjgc33